In this case, it's possible that the high number of cookies and caches blocks you from managing your employee's info and some features in the program. We can perform the basic troubleshooting steps to help fix your browser to work better and faster.
Here's how:
Restart your browser.
Log in to your account in an incognito or private browser and see if you can fix the error. You can use these keyboard shortcuts to launch a new private window:
Google Chrome: press Ctrl + Shift + N
Mozilla Firefox: press Ctrl + Shift + P
Safari: press Command + Shift + N
If it works on the private browser, you can go back to the regular browser and clear your browser's cache. Then, see if it works, and you can go through it in opening the page. Otherwise, you can use another supported browser.
